Project Abstract
The global demand for sustainable energy sources has led to increased research and development efforts towards the production of biofuels. Algae have emerged as a promising feedstock for biofuel production due to their high growth rates, ability to grow in various environments, and potential for high lipid content. This research project aims to develop a novel process for sustainable biofuel production from algae, focusing on maximizing biofuel yield while minimizing environmental impact. The research begins with a comprehensive introduction outlining the background of the study, the problem statement, objectives, limitations, scope, significance, structure, and definition of terms. A thorough literature review in Chapter Two explores existing research on algae biofuel production, different cultivation methods, lipid extraction techniques, and challenges faced in commercializing algae biofuels. Chapter Three details the research methodology employed in this study, including the selection of algae strains, cultivation conditions, lipid extraction methods, and biofuel conversion processes. The methodology also addresses sustainability aspects, such as water and nutrient recycling, to ensure an environmentally friendly biofuel production process. Chapter Four presents the findings of the research, including the lipid content of different algae strains, the efficiency of lipid extraction methods, and the quality of biofuels produced. The discussion delves into the technical, economic, and environmental aspects of the novel biofuel production process, highlighting its potential for scalability and commercial viability. Finally, Chapter Five provides a comprehensive conclusion and summary of the research project. The study demonstrates the feasibility of developing a sustainable biofuel production process from algae, emphasizing the importance of optimizing cultivation and extraction techniques to achieve high biofuel yields. The findings contribute to the growing body of knowledge on algae biofuel production and pave the way for further research and development in the field of renewable energy. In conclusion, the "Development of a Novel Process for Sustainable Biofuel Production from Algae" project represents a significant step towards realizing the potential of algae as a renewable energy source. By addressing key challenges and optimizing biofuel production processes, this research contributes to the ongoing efforts to create a more sustainable and environmentally friendly energy future.
Project Overview
The project topic, "Development of a Novel Process for Sustainable Biofuel Production from Algae," focuses on the innovative approach to producing biofuels using algae as a sustainable and environmentally friendly source. Algae are a promising alternative to traditional fossil fuels due to their high growth rate, minimal land use requirements, and ability to capture carbon dioxide during photosynthesis. The project aims to develop a novel process that optimizes the production of biofuels from algae while minimizing environmental impact and maximizing energy efficiency.
The research will begin with a comprehensive review of the current state of biofuel production from algae, highlighting existing challenges and opportunities in the field. By examining the latest advancements in algae cultivation, harvesting, and conversion technologies, the study will identify gaps in the existing processes that can be addressed through innovation and optimization.
The novel process developed in this research will integrate various stages of algae cultivation, harvesting, and conversion into a cohesive and efficient system. By leveraging cutting-edge technologies and sustainable practices, the project seeks to improve the overall efficiency and viability of algae-based biofuel production. This includes exploring novel cultivation methods, such as photobioreactors or open pond systems, optimizing harvesting techniques to maximize biomass yield, and enhancing conversion processes to extract biofuels with high energy content.
Moreover, the project will consider the environmental sustainability aspects of algae biofuel production, such as minimizing water and nutrient usage, reducing carbon emissions, and mitigating potential ecological impacts. By adopting a holistic approach that considers the entire lifecycle of biofuel production, the research aims to develop a process that is not only economically viable but also environmentally responsible.
Overall, the "Development of a Novel Process for Sustainable Biofuel Production from Algae" project represents a significant step towards advancing the field of bioenergy by harnessing the potential of algae as a renewable and environmentally friendly feedstock. Through innovation, optimization, and sustainable practices, the research endeavors to contribute to the development of a more sustainable and energy-secure future.
